Bhutan’s Working Party on Accession held its 5th meeting on 9 July 2026, marking the country’s return to WTO accession negotiations after an 18-year pause. WTO members welcomed Bhutan back to the negotiating table, and Bhutan reaffirmed its commitment to joining the organization while noting economic progress since 2008.
